What is Parallel Ledger?

The new GL functions include “Parallel Accounting” , it’s
an SAP feature where you can maintain different sets of
books to satisfy all different requirements of Financial
Statement users accurately, efficiently and effectively.
Standard reports are already available and readily
available to use.
